Transaction 608576e89ccbdb6c9051b6ea63239497b7a26a8f2a2b4baf6773a4e2d14096ca

3 Input
2 Outputs
  • 608576e89ccbdb6c9051b6ea63239497b7a26a8f2a2b4baf6773a4e2d14096ca:0
  • value  10557344
    address  18Gyq3LvNHY6t9ZywNTsHUZ9GPtL5o9MY7
  • 608576e89ccbdb6c9051b6ea63239497b7a26a8f2a2b4baf6773a4e2d14096ca:1
  • value  37431886
    address  1Fiq52SgdXLLreJxDuBZ8NjmSAgiCHAEXR